Understanding Bitcoin: Exploring the Foundations
Bitcoin emerged as a disruptive force in the financial landscape, captivating the attention of investors, enthusiasts, and skeptics alike. To fully grasp the significance of this revolutionary concept, it’s essential to delve into the foundations that underpin its operation.
Bitcoin operates on a decentralized network, employing blockchain technology to maintain a secure and transparent record of transactions. Unlike traditional currencies controlled by central authorities, Bitcoin empowers individuals to engage in peer-to-peer transactions without the need for intermediaries. Key features:
- Decentralization: Bitcoin is not controlled by any single entity or government, making it resistant to regulation and external influences.
- Transparency: All transactions are recorded on the public blockchain, accessible for anyone to scrutinize.
- Security: Bitcoin employs robust encryption techniques to safeguard transactions and protect user information.
Navigating the Bitcoin Market: Trends and Patterns
The Bitcoin market is constantly evolving, making it crucial to stay informed about the latest trends and patterns. Here are a few key factors to consider:
- Volatility: Bitcoin is known for its volatility, with sharp price fluctuations both up and down. This volatility is influenced by various factors, such as news events, regulatory changes, and market sentiment.
- Market capitalization: The market capitalization of Bitcoin, referring to the total value of all bitcoins in circulation, provides an indication of its overall market value and liquidity. Changes in market capitalization can signal market sentiment and potential price movements.
- Trading volume: The trading volume, representing the amount of Bitcoin being bought and sold, reflects market activity and liquidity. High trading volume often indicates increased interest and potential volatility.

Investing in Bitcoin: Essential Strategies and Considerations
Essential Strategies and Considerations for Bitcoin Investment
To optimize investing in Bitcoin, implementing a strategic approach is crucial. Dollar-cost averaging is an effective strategy, involving investing regular amounts at fixed intervals, regardless of price fluctuations. This approach reduces the impact of market volatility and smoothens entry into the market.
Understanding risk tolerance and asset allocation is paramount. As a volatile asset, Bitcoin requires a calibrated risk appetite. Investors should determine their comfort level with fluctuations and allocate funds accordingly. Diversification across traditional investments and alternative assets like Bitcoin can help manage overall portfolio risk. Consider hedging strategies, such as shorting Bitcoin futures contracts or utilizing exchange-traded notes that track the inverse price of Bitcoin, to mitigate potential losses during market downturns.
